Lot description:


Anastasius I, 491-518. Follis (Bronze, 37 mm, 17.80 g, 6 h), Constantinopolis, 512-517. D N ANASTA-SIVS P P AVG Diademed, draped and cuirassed bust of Anastasius I to right. Rev. Large M flanked by two six-pointed stars; above, cross; below, B; in exergue, CON. DOC 23b. MIBE 27. SB 19. Boldly struck and unusually well preserved. Repatinated and with very light doubling, otherwise, extremely fine.


From a European collection, formed before 2005.
